    How to restore my iPod
    I got my iPod nano 3rd gen from a friend who had a Mac, and I have a Windows PC. The iPod is not formatted for my computer. I know I have to restore it, but when I connect it to my computer, it is not recognized by either iTunes or My Computer. I need to know if there is another way for my computer to recognize my iPod.

    I don't think it's that your iPod isn't formatted for your computer. There is probably something wrong with your usb port if it doesn't come up in my computer. Have you been able to use the usb port for anything else?
